解决单一Redis服务器的读取上限问题(单redis的读上限)

尽管 Redis 无可比拟的性能优势,但如果仅使用一个单独的 Redis 服务器,在受限的硬件资源下很容易达到读取上限,这将对应用程序的性能造成严重影响。当单台服务器无法满足业务的需求时,最佳的解决方案就是使用分布式 Redis 集群。

分布式 Redis 集群是一种将多台 Redis 服务器联合起来一起处理用户请求的方式,它可以通过在不同节点上执行多个操作来提升性能。另一方面,Redis 集群还具有故障转移和容灾恢复的功能,即使某些服务器发生故障,也可以确保对于用户的服务数据不丢失。

创建和管理一个 Redis 集群需要一定的过程和技术能力,让普通开发者在配置 Redis 集群时难以实施。DingTalk 基于 Redis 的高可用模块推出的 Redis 百度云产品即可解决该问题,开发者可以通过 GUI 操作界面快速管理 Redis 集群,免去了繁琐、复杂的配置过程。

开发者可以通过提供一个集群节点的信息(地理位置等),然后在 GUI 操作界面中设置 Redis 集群的总节点数目,并以此来自动部署 Redis 集群,用户也可以灵活添加 Redis 节点。

此外,在 Redis 百度云产品中,还提供了多种管理功能,比如查看集群信息、查看 Redis 节点信息、备份和还原 Redis 数据等。同时,它还支持上线部署,开发者可以快速将应用程序的设置发布到生产环境。

因此,基于 Redis 百度云产品的分布式 Redis 集群架构可以有效地提升 Redis 读取的吞吐量,它是一种可靠和易于管理的方案,适用于比较庞大而高性能的原机应用。


数据运维技术 » 解决单一Redis服务器的读取上限问题(单redis的读上限)